About Beaver Lake Sailing Club

 

The Beaver Lake Sailing Club (BLSC) is located near Rogers nestled in the Lost Bridge community of Beaver Lake in beautiful Northwest Arkansas.

 

The club was founded in 1968 as a non profit organization by a handful of avid day sailors with the intention of promoting the sport of sailing in Northwest Arkansas.  Organized activities and racing were initially held in the Rocky Branch area of Beaver Lake.  The local marina dock served as the gathering place for skipper’s meetings.

 

In 1978 a group of 8 club members banded together as the Arkansas Yacht Partnership (AYP) purchasing approximately 5 acres in the Lost Bridge area for new club facilities.  In 1979 AYP sold the property to the Beaver Lake Sailing Club creating its new home.  Six moorings were anchored in the cove in front of the property.  By 1981 the first dock with 8 slips was completed.  As membership increased the club purchased the adjacent property bringing the total acreage to 10.

 

To date the club has five docks which are home to approximately 70 vessels.  The upper parking lot provides dry storage for trailer sailors.  Tie ups at the end of each dock are provided for visiting yachts.

 

The racing schedule includes both a Spring and Fall series.  A PHRF scoring system is used for handicapping.  The Arkansas Cup series are long distance races held on three days spread throughout the year.  The club also hosts the Annual NEBCO Regatta in late September.  All proceeds from the regatta are to benefit the Northeast Benton County Volunteer Fire Department.

 

In addition to an aggressive racing schedule, the BLSC also hosts a number of organized club activities for its members such as raft-ups, full moon sails, and cook-outs.
